Is the supreme deity of the Hindu mythology, also the god of storms and atmospheric. He was called the Mighty God of Lightning, Cloud Creator and the Creator of rain. He was constantly at war with the underworld or immoral demons, fighting an ongoing battle between good and evil. As the god of war, was guardian of this.

Is considered as the god of the Sun. Surya is depicted as a red man with three eyes and four arms, riding in a chariot drawn by seven mares. Surya holds water lilies in two of his hands. With his third hand he calls the faithful, who blesses with his fourth hand. In India, Surya is considered a benevolent deity capable of healing the sick.

He rides through the sky in a chariot drawn by white horses. Soma was also the elixir of immortality that the gods could only drink. It was thought that the moon was the elixir store. When the gods drink soma, it is said that the moon is disappearing and that the gods are taking some of their properties
